2. Consider Rental Duration and Flexibility

Ask about the rental period included in the price. Some companies offer a set number of days with additional fees for extended use. Make sure the service provides enough time to complete your cleanup without pressure.

3. Check Local Regulations and Permits

Dumpsters placed on public streets or sidewalks often require permits from your city. An experienced dumpster rental company can usually assist with this process or advise you on local rules. Ensure the provider complies with all regulations to avoid fines or delays.

5. Confirm Dumpster Placement Options

Discuss where the dumpster will be placed on your property. Ensure there is enough space and accessible ground to support the bin during your rental period. Some services also offer drop-off on private property or nearby streets, subject to permit rules.

6. Inquire About Waste Disposal Practices

Responsible dumpster rental companies sort and recycle materials where possible. If environmental impact matters to you, select a company that prioritizes sustainable waste management and will recycle appropriate debris.

Tips for Planning Your Dumpster Rental Successfully

To make the most out of your dumpster rental, consider these practical tips:

  1. Estimate your waste volume: Overestimate slightly to choose the right dumpster size.
  2. Plan delivery timing: Schedule dumpster drop-off after your project start to avoid long-standing bins.
  3. Separate recyclables: Sort materials like metal, wood, and drywall prior to disposal.
  4. Avoid prohibited items: Common prohibited materials include batteries, tires, electronics, and chemicals.
  5. Communicate clearly: Inform the rental company of any special access or location requirements.

Dumpster Rental FAQ

Q1: What is the average cost of dumpster rental?
The cost varies widely depending on location, dumpster size, and rental time, but most residential rentals range from $300 to $600 for a week-long rental. Pricing can increase if additional fees apply.

Q2: Can I rent a dumpster for a day or less?
Most dumpster rental companies offer minimum rental periods of 3-7 days. However, some locations or services might allow shorter rentals for small projects.

Q3: What materials can I put in a rented dumpster?
Typically, dumpsters accept construction debris, household junk, yard waste, and non-hazardous materials. Avoid hazardous, electronic, or flammable items. Confirm specifics with your rental provider.
